If it’s shade of teeth that you are concerned about, now is the time to invest in a cosmetic treatment. You could opt for tooth whitening. There are multiple options within this category, from over-the-counter bleaching trays to professional whitening at the dentist. You can opt for instant or gradual results to ensure you have total control over how white you’d like to go. If your New Year’s resolution is to opt for whiter teeth, start researching – and remember, your dentist will be happy to advise you on the best solutions for you.

If gaps are a concern, dental bridges or implants could mean that you enter 2016 with this no longer being a worry. These are artificial teeth fitted in the gaps and bonded to the existing teeth on either side. Another option is dental implants, which are actually attached to the jawbone. Both are done to exactly match and fit with your existing teeth so that no-one except you will know that there was once a gap.

If it’s the angle of your teeth or an overbite or underbite which is concerning you, now is the time to consult an orthodontist and see which options are available to you. With the wide range of braces and treatments on the market, a total smile makeover is entirely possible. Options include invisible braces and natural coloured tooth brackets so again no-one except yourself need know about the change you’re making.
